Madam Speaker, I move to suspend the rules and pass the bill (H.R. 8416) to improve individual assistance provided by the Federal Emergency Management Agency, and for other purposes, as amended. The Clerk read the title of the bill. The text of the bill is as follows: H.R. 8416 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the United States of America in Congress assembled, SECTION 1. SHORT TITLE; TABLE OF CONTENTS. (a) Short Title.--This Act may be cited as the ``Disaster Survivors Fairness Act of 2022''. (b) Table of Contents.--The table of contents for this Act is as follows: Sec. 1. Short title; table of contents. Sec. 2. Information sharing for Federal agencies. Sec. 3. Universal application for individual assistance. Sec. 4. Repair and rebuilding. Sec. 5. Direct assistance. Sec. 6. State-managed housing pilot authority. Sec. 7. Management costs. Sec. 8. Individual assistance post-disaster housing study. Sec. 9. Funding for online guides for post-disaster assistance. Sec. 10. Individual assistance dashboard. Sec. 11. FEMA reports. Sec. 12. Sheltering of emergency response personnel. Sec. 13. GAO report on preliminary damage assessments. Sec. 14. Applicability. (c) Definitions.--Except as otherwise provided, the terms used in this Act have the meanings given such terms in section 102 of the Robert T. Stafford Disaster Relief and Emergency Assistance Act (42 U.S.C. 5122). SEC. 2. INFORMATION SHARING FOR FEDERAL AGENCIES.…
